If you need to remove a document from the search results as quickly as possible, the x robots noindex tag will be a better solution for you. Instead of a meta tag, you can also return an xrobotstag header with a value of either noindex or none in your response. For the most part, the directives of are the same as for the meta robots tag. Unfortunately, however you noindex a file, it can some time to disappear from the index and from search results. For example, many of my multimedia files are not included in search results.
If you are using the yoast seo plugin, then it comes with a robots. Xrobotstag in seo optimization netpeak software blog. Thats true whether you use a meta noindex or x robots tag. Noindexing pdfs throught xrobotstag search console. In order to apply the xrobots noindex tag to you will need to be able to edit your. The rep also includes directives like meta robots, as well as page, subdirectory, or sitewide instructions. Can i noindex, follow a specific page using x robots in. Tools page in your wordpress admin and click on the file editor link. The web developers seo cheat sheet get technical insights. After crawling a site, you can easily check the noindex pages report to view all pages that are noindexed via the meta robots tag, the xrobotstag header response, or by using noindex in robots.
You can export the list and then filter in excel to isolate pages noindexed via the xrobotstag. A big part of doing seo is about sending the right signals to search engines, and the robots. If theyre already indexed, theyll drop out over time if you use the xrobottag with the noindex directive. When youre dealing with nonhtml files such as images and pdf files you don. Any robots meta tag directive can also be specified as an x robots tag. Header set xrobotstag noindex, noarchive, nosnippet why use xrobots tag instead of robots. Preventing your site from being indexed, the right way yoast. On the other hand, the x robots tag can be added to nonhtml files.
Most of the search engines conform to using this protocol. In addition to the meta suggestions below, here is a solution to target certain pages across an entire site. How to prevent a pdf file from being indexed by search. Taking advantage of the xrobots tag perishable press. The robots meta tag cannot be used for nonhtml files such as images, text files, or pdf documents. Pdf files across an entire site, add the following snippet to the sites root. Sep 03, 2019 the x robots tag differs from the robots. Thats true whether you use a meta noindex or xrobotstag. Customize one of the following htaccess scripts according to your indexing needs and add it to your sites root htaccess file or apache configuration file. The issue with a tag like that though, is that you have to add it to each and every page. Theory is nice and all, but lets see how you could use the xrobotstag in the wild. Blocking the robots ip address could be an option but as these spammers usually use different ip addresses it can be a tiresome process.
You might be familiar with the robots exclusion protocol rep, often communicated by a robots. Block search indexing with noindex search console help. With the help of x robots tag, we can rectify this problem. To implement xrobotstag directives for non php files, such as pdf, flash, and word documents, it is possible to set the headers via htaccess. One of the most common methods for defining which information is to be excluded is by using the robot exclusion protocol. You can optionally identify a specific crawler for a directive, and pair that with a separate directive for all other crawlers not specified, as shown in the following sample. Xrobotstag is a kind of response header, it can tell search engine how to process your html page. Add noindex xrobotstag to prevent search engines from. Only meta robots and xrobotstag remove urls from search results dont block css or javascript files with robots. How to hide noindex a pdf in wordpress from search. If a page is disallowed from crawling through the robots.
On the other hand, the xrobotstag can be added to nonhtml files. In addition to being used for different types of files, the format is different as well. Sometimes we need to let search engine robots know that certain information should not be retrieved and stored by them. In order to apply the noindex to all pdf s on your site, add the following command. Handling this case would be much easier in php than in. Mar 04, 2020 x robots tag is another way to manage robots behavior on your website. Ive found some instructions for noindexing types of files, but i cant find instruction to noindex a single page, and what i have tried so far hasnt worked. Heres an example of adding a noindex xrobotstag directive for images. If you want to prevent search engines from showing files youve generated with php, you could add the following in the head of the header. You can also use the xrobots tag to disallow both the crawl and indexing of these documents. Jun 05, 2017 the issue with a tag like that though, is that you have to add it to each and every page. Instead of a meta tag, you can also return an x robots tag header with a value of either noindex or none in your response. If you have a nonhtml file, such as a pdf or video, you can use the x robots tag instead.
The simplest way to prevent pdf documents from appearing in search results is to add an xrobotstag. Simply go to seo tools page in your wordpress admin and click on the file editor link. Header set x robotstag noindex, nofollow header set xrobotstag noindex. But what if you want to prevent search engines from indexing files such as images or pdfs. Header set xrobotstag noindex, noarchive, nosnippet. Oct 22, 2019 xrobotstag is a kind of response header, it can tell search engine how to process your html page. If you have a nonhtml file, such as a pdf or video, you can use the xrobots tag instead. Finally, you can have the same control over your videos, spreadsheets, and other indexed file types. Nov 08, 2015 after crawling a site, you can easily check the noindex pages report to view all pages that are noindexed via the meta robots tag, the xrobotstag header response, or by using noindex in robots. For the noindex directive to be effective, the page must not be blocked by a robots. With the help of xrobotstag, we can rectify this problem. However, an x robots tag offers some additional flexibility and functionality on top. The ultimate guide to blocking content in search via. You can use the xrobotstag for nonhtml files like image files where the usage of robots meta tags in html is not possible.
Header set xrobotstag noindex, noarchive, nosnippet it is supposed to noindex all the pdf files of the website. Compared to robots meta tags, x robots tag is used for more specific directives such as noindex pdf or image files. The robots meta tag is fine for implementing noindex directives on html pages here and there. How to check the xrobotstag for noindex and nofollow directives. For nonhtml files such as pdf files and images its the only way to signal indexing preferences, so thats what its used for mostly. Where the meta tag doesnt use the word tag in the coding, the xrobotstag does. We can check any requested header and we can use any regular expression to match the files we want to add to the header.
Where the meta tag doesnt use the word tag in the coding, the x robots tag does. Dec 24, 2017 therefore, i added a xrobots tag in the. Pdf files still indexed when xrobotstag noindex set in. In order to apply the noindex to all pdfs on your site, add the.
How to hide noindex a pdf in wordpress from search engines. How to check the xrobotstag for noindex and nofollow. This website uses cookies to ensure you get the best experience on our website. Noindexing pdfs throught xrobotstag search console community. With a few simple lines of text in your websites apache htaccess configuration file, we can prevent search engines from including sensitive pages and folders in its search results. If you want to exclude a page or file from search engines, use the meta robots tag or x. Using the example above, lets say your promotion page is in pdf format. However, an xrobotstag offers some additional flexibility and functionality on top. In order to apply the noindex to all pdfs on your site, add the following command. Make sure you arent blocking these requests in robots. Some could be malicious, even if you create a section in your robots. Googlebot doesnt see the xrobotstag behind nginx, despite we see it as header response.
525 1134 969 1469 1116 1298 605 558 934 323 1119 954 944 868 1572 491 539 1395 733 406 1271 432 110 1400 144 64 1527 1392 162 965 608 42 113 1185 341 704 1092 210 303 72 203 275 125 744 1379 58 1344 722